Output cd6268650ee2e0f841734170c5e77ac9b163a01e7a422904f987d8fbe60c229d:9

value
298220
script pubkey
OP_0 OP_PUSHBYTES_20 59d93e44cc4131f09a8d5036761fdb2893c04504
address
bc1qt8vnu3xvgyclpx5d2qm8v87m9zfuq3gynx8jkr
transaction
cd6268650ee2e0f841734170c5e77ac9b163a01e7a422904f987d8fbe60c229d
confirmations
83609
spent
true